200 Years of Change is a instrumental majestic ballad for solo flute and piano. The piece has a clear classical reference, with a strong visual character.
It was originally commissioned by Lindås municipality and School of Arts in 2014, and in conjunction with the bicentenary for the Norwegian Constitution 1814–2014. It was originally composed for brass band, choir, band and trumpet solo.
200 years of evolving Norwegian democracy clearly signify pride and humbleness, let’s hope it will remain, or that the nation will build within the same framework for the future.
(duration: c.4 min)
Level: Intermediate
